
The passenger ship, which travels between the lake centers throughout the season, can also be appropriate for exploring Lake Altmühlsee in a relaxed method. A shipping line on which the MS Altmühlsee operates connects the three lake centers (Wald, Muhr am See and Schlungenhof).
